Zacatecas vs Kasempa Climate & Distance Between

Zambia flag
  • The distance between Zacatecas, Mexico and Kasempa, Zambia is approximately 14,496 km or 9,008 mi.
  • To reach Zacatecas in this distance one would set out from Kasempa bearing 288.6°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Zacatecas bearing 268.6° or W .
  • Zacatecas has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Kasempa has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Zacatecas is in or near the warm temperate thorn steppe biome whereas Kasempa is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 7.3 °C (13.1°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.1 °C (0.2°F) less in Zacatecas.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 719.8 mm (28.3 in) less which is equivalent to 719.8 l/m² (17.67 US gal/ft²) or 7,198,000 l/ha (769,514 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.5° lower in Zacatecas than in Kasempa.
  • Relative humidity levels are 10.5%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.6°C (17.3°F) lower.
